    Can indoor cats nonetheless get rabies?

    Sure, indoor cats can nonetheless get rabies if they’re bitten by an contaminated animal, usually a raccoon, bat, or skunk. So, even when your cat is an indoor cat, it is nonetheless essential to observe the advisable vaccination schedule.

    How typically do kittens want rabies photographs?

    Kittens usually want their first rabies shot at 12-16 weeks previous, with a booster shot given 1 12 months later. After that, most cats will want a rabies shot each 1-3 years, relying in your veterinarian’s suggestion.
